Top 17 Wedding Styles: The Most Beautiful Wedding Stationery & Wedding Invitations

Your wedding stationery is what will hint towards your wedding theme and mood from the moment you decide to announce your wedding day. Consider your wedding stationery to be an equally important part of your wedding décor, and make sure it’s consistent with your theme and in in line with your vision. Even the wording and tone of your voice when writing your wedding invitations will be a key detail of your overall wedding style. After all, you cannot invite your family to an elegant, luxurious wedding, but then use informal phrases and slang!

Here are a few tips as well as our favorite & prettiest wedding stationery trends for 2021 to inspire you!

Let’s start by what Wedding Stationery includes :

To make things clearer and easier for you, we have grouped all types of stationery by specific wedding event. This list is quite handy as you can use it as a reference when planning & designing your wedding invitations and stationery.

1- Wedding Announcements & Wedding Invitations :

This part includes your wedding save-the-date or wedding announcement, the invitation cards, and the RSVP cards. You might also want to include a map to your wedding location or your wedding registry details.

2- Your Wedding Ceremony:

The ceremony’s program, mass booklets and prayer book covers (if you are having a religious ceremony), personalized confetti cones, song lyrics, etc. will make your wedding ceremony extra special

3- Your Wedding Reception:

Your wedding reception should include place cards & seating charts, table numbers & names. On the wedding tables, you can even add customized wedding menus, guests’ names, favor labels, customized labels for your wine bottles, special notes for your guests, etc.

4- Post-Wedding:

End your wedding on a thoughtful (and pretty) note with thank you cards while your guests are leaving, small favors or dessert packages, etc. You can even send thank you cards or emails after a couple of days.

5- For your destination wedding, you might want to use additional welcome stationery elements:

Welcome package labels & notes to greet your guests, printed destination wedding activities program, maps, and other useful information will all be greatly appreciated by your guests who traveled far to celebrate your wedding.

Elegant designs and luxurious styles

Looking for sophistication and elegance? Then think of wedding stationery with vellum (type of translucent sheets) overlays, laser-cut designs, embossed writing – all in a subtle soft color palette. Such details will guarantee that you’ll have luxurious and fancy wedding stationery.

Rustic vibes from the first glance

Nothing says rustic like burlap, kraft paper, lace, and wildflowers. Mix them with high-quality paper and earthy natural materials like rope, and you will have the most beautiful rustic wedding stationery!

Clean lines and minimalistic stationery

Simple texts, clean lines, and fonts, will be the epitome of less is more! If you are going for the minimalistic wedding theme, focus on neutral palettes, negative (but in a positive way) spaces, and simple typographies – all printed on high-grade card stock.

Sustainable materials and plantable papers

Sustainability is at the heart of every conversation or event, including weddings. Make a (pretty) gesture to the planet without compromising design, aesthetics, and bridal vibes by going for eco-friendly wedding stationery using recyclable papers or plantable seed papers. Environmentally friendly and unique!
